### Understanding Pie Charts
Pie charts are circular diagrams that divide the whole into sectors or slices, each representing a proportion of the total data. They are particularly useful for showing how a whole is divided into different parts. ### Best Practices for Effective Data Representation
To maximize the impact of your pie charts using PieChartMaster, remember the following best practices:

1. **Simplicity is Key**: Avoid overcrowding your pie chart with too many slices. Keep it simple by limiting the number of categories to ensure clarity and ease of interpretation.

2. **Proper Data Labeling**: Ensure that each slice is clearly labeled with its corresponding category and percentage, aiding users in understanding the chart quickly.

3. **Color Usage**: Use distinct, contrasting colors to represent slices. Consider the color palette and its impact on accessibility, particularly for individuals with color vision deficiencies.

4. **Focus on the Message**: Tailor the pie chart’s design to effectively convey a message. Avoid using pie charts for comparisons when there are significant data disparities, preferring bar charts or line graphs instead.
